Liverpool name asking price for Harvey Elliott as surprise contender emerges in race to sign England U21 international

Elliott is being strongly linked with a move away from Liverpool.

Jack Kenmare

Jack Kenmare

google discoverFollow us on Google Discover

Liverpool have named their asking price for Harvey Elliott after a number of clubs from around Europe, including Bundesliga side RB Leipzig, expressed an interest in signing the in-form midfielder.

Elliott is currently thriving at the European Under-21 Championship, where he recently helped Lee Carsley's England secure their place in the final after netting twice against the Netherlands.

The 22-year-old has certainly caught the eye with a number of impressive performances. Brighton and West Ham are interested, according to the Daily Mail, while Bundesliga outfit RB Leipzig are also said to be admirers.

Wolves, on the other hands, have pulled out of the race after being deterred by his price tag.

Liverpool want 'at least' £40 million for the midfielder, although that amount is expected to increase given his performances for England at this summer's Euros.

Elliott, who made 28 appearances in all competitions for Liverpool across 2024/25, struggled to nail down a regular spot in Arne Slot's side last season.

The Mail suggest that Slot was initially impressed with the former Fulham man during pre-season, but was 'less pleased' by his levels in training following a two-month lay-off with a foot injury.

In fact, Elliott is believed to be fourth in the pecking order when it comes to his favoured No 10 role, with Florian Wirtz, Dominik Szoboszlai, and Curtis Jones being favoured by the manager.

Speaking to LFCTV during the club's Premier League celebrations last month, Elliott appeared to hint that his time at Anfield could be coming to an end.

“I think this one, I’ve played more of a part in winning the league,” he said, referring back to the club's Premier League title win in 2019/20. “The season that we won it last time I was still a young kid, I think I only made four appearances or something like that.

“So now it definitely feels like I’ve been in and around it a lot.

“Since coming back from my injury I’ve been in every squad, so just being part of it, just doing the travelling, the away games, all the stuff outside of playing, it feels a lot greater this time. I’m just trying to enjoy every experience of it, because you never know what’s going to happen."

He added: “You can’t take these moments for granted, you just need to enjoy it as much as you can, celebrate as much as you can as well.”

What has Arne Slot said about Harvey Elliott?

Back in May, Slot explained why Elliott did not feature in his side as often as the player may have expected.

“Harvey is one of the players who hasn’t had as much playing time as he maybe deserves, but like some others he’s in competition with so many good players that mainly I’ve chosen," Slot said.

“Also partly because he was injured for a long time and I’ve been honest with him, the first part after he came back from his injury he wasn’t the same as he was before his injury. But the last few months he’s back to his old level again."
